Barn floor repair services focus on restoring the integrity and appearance of a barn’s flooring system. Over time, wooden barn floors can develop issues such as rotting, warping, or splitting due to age, moisture, or heavy use. Repair work may involve replacing damaged planks, reinforcing weakened areas, or leveling uneven sections to ensure a safe and functional surface. These services help maintain the overall stability of the barn, making it safer for livestock, equipment, or storage needs.
Many common problems that barn floor repair addresses include sagging or sunken areas caused by wood decay or soil shifting beneath the floor. Moisture intrusion can lead to rot, which weakens the structural support. Additionally, cracked or split boards can pose safety hazards or cause further damage if not addressed promptly. Repairing these issues helps prevent more extensive structural problems and extends the lifespan of the barn’s flooring system.

The overview below groups typical Barn Floor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Wichita Falls, TX.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or barn floor repairs in Wichita Falls range from $250 to $600. Many routine patching and leveling j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of damage. Fewer projects reach the higher end of this spectrum.
Moderate Projects - Mid-sized repairs, such as replacing sections of flooring or addressing significant cracks, generally cost between $600 and $1,500. Local contractors often handle these projects regularly, with costs varying based on size and materials used.
Large-Scale Repairs - Extensive repairs involving multiple sections or structural reinforcement can range from $1,500 to $3,500. Larger, more complex projects are less common but may be necessary for older or heavily damaged barns.
Full Replacement - Complete barn floor replacements typically start around $3,500 and can exceed $5,000 for larger, more intricate projects. These are usually reserved for severely deteriorated floors requiring comprehensive work by experienced service providers.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es barn floors to become damaged? Barn floors can suffer damage from moisture, heavy equipment, or improper installation, leading to issues like warping, cracking, or rotting.
How can barn floor damage be repaired? Local contractors typically assess the extent of damage and may replace or reinforce sections of the flooring to restore stability and safety.
What types of flooring materials are used in barn repairs? Common materials include treated wood, concrete, and durable composite options, selected based on the barn’s use and existing structure.
Are there ways to prevent future barn floor damage? Proper ventilation, regular inspections, and timely repairs can help prevent further issues with barn flooring.
